Formal Pronunciation of Eimear

When it comes to formal situations, such as addressing someone professionally or introducing them in an official setting, it’s essential to pronounce “Eimear” accurately. Here is the preferred pronunciation:

EE-mer: This is the most widely accepted and formal pronunciation of the name “Eimear”. The first syllable sounds like the double ‘e’ sound in “meet”, while the second syllable rhymes with “her”.

To ensure clarity, it’s essential to enunciate each syllable distinctly and avoid rushing through the pronunciation. Practice saying “Eimear” slowly and emphasize the ‘EE’ sound at the beginning and the ‘er’ sound at the end.

Informal Pronunciation of Eimear

In more relaxed and casual environments, such as among friends and family, the pronunciation of “Eimear” can slightly differ. Let’s explore the informal ways to say this lovely name:

  • AY-mer: In informal settings, some individuals may pronounce “Eimear” as “AY-mer”. The first syllable sounds like the long ‘a’ sound in “say”, followed by the rhyming sound of “her”. This pronunciation is commonly heard in various English-speaking countries.
  • EE-mra: Another informal pronunciation is “EE-mra”. Here, the ‘ee’ sound remains the same as in the formal pronunciation, but the second syllable is shortened and pronounced as “mra”. This version might be more common in certain regional dialects.

While informal pronunciations may vary, it’s essential to remember that the person named “Eimear” should always have the final say on how their name is pronounced. Respect their preferred pronunciation and adjust accordingly.
